Jason Collins, NBA’s First Openly Gay Player, Dies at 47

Jason Collins: A Trailblazer Remembered
Jason Collins, a former NBA center, has died at the age of 47 following a battle with glioblastoma. Collins made history in 2013 when he publicly came out as gay, becoming the first openly gay athlete in the four major North American professional sports leagues. His announcement was met with widespread support and marked a significant moment for LGBTQ+ inclusion in sports. His family confirmed his death, highlighting his impact on countless lives. The NBA also released a statement acknowledging his profound influence and expressing condolences.

A Pioneering Announcement
In 2013, Jason Collins penned an essay in Sports Illustrated titled “I’m a 34-year-old NBA center. I’m black. And I’m gay.”. This declaration was a groundbreaking moment, shattering barriers in professional sports. Collins revealed that he had been contemplating coming out since 2011, weighing the potential impact on his career and personal life. His decision to share his truth was met with an outpouring of support from fellow athletes, celebrities, and political figures.

NBA Career
Jason Collins had a 13-year NBA career, playing for multiple teams, including the New Jersey Nets, Memphis Grizzlies, Minnesota Timberwolves, Atlanta Hawks, Boston Celtics, Washington Wizards, and Brooklyn Nets. Known for his size, physicality, and defensive skills, Collins was a reliable player and teammate. Though not a high-scoring star, his contributions on the court were valued by his teams. His career statistics reflect his role as a dependable center who provided valuable minutes and leadership.

Obama and Nash Support
The support Jason Collins received after coming out was remarkable. Then-President Barack Obama personally called him to express his support. This gesture underscored the significance of Collins’ decision and the importance of leadership in promoting equality. Obama’s public endorsement sent a powerful message of acceptance and solidarity.
Steve Nash, a two-time NBA MVP, also voiced his support, tweeting “maximum respect” for Collins. Nash’s statement exemplified the support Collins received from his peers in the NBA.
